SUMMARY:Exhibition Opening Reception | HOPE: Stories of Houston Survivors
DESCRIPTION:Since 1996\, Holocaust Museum Houston has been committed to honoring Holocaust survivors’ legacy and ensuring Houston Survivor stories live on in perpetuity. This annual exhibition offers a video introduction of Houston Holocaust Survivors featuring family members’ testimonies and clips of Survivors telling their stories. Family artifacts will also be showcased throughout the exhibition. This installment of the exhibition will include local Holocaust Survivors Wolf Finkelman\, Al Marks\, Ruth Schnitzer\, Otto Schlamme\, Lissa Streusand\, Ben Waserman and Zoly Zamir.

SUMMARY:Film Screening | "Los Hermanos/The Brothers"
DESCRIPTION:Photo by Najib Joe Hakim \nJoin Holocaust Museum Houston for a screening of the film Los Hermanos/The Brothers and a special performance by the Segundo Barrio Children’s Chorus. \nVirtuoso Afro-Cuban-born brothers—violinist Ilmar and pianist Aldo—live on opposite sides of a geopolitical chasm a half-century wide. Tracking their parallel lives in New York and Havana\, their poignant reunion\, and their momentous first performances together\, Los Hermanos/The Brothers offers a nuanced\, often startling view of estranged nations through the lens of music and family. \nThis event will feature a special performance by the Segundo Barrio Children’s Chorus. Segundo Barrio Children’s Chorus is Houston’s first and only bilingual choir for children. Their mission is to enrich the lives of children and families through music education and performance opportunities which engage residents\, build communities\, and share with visitors the unique cultural identity of Segundo Barrio/East End. \nThis event is free and open to the public. SUMMARY:Film Screening | "Zero Gravity"
DESCRIPTION:Join Holocaust Museum Houston for a screening of the film Zero Gravity followed by a special presentation from the University of Houston’s SACNAS Chapter. \nZero Gravity follows a diverse group of middle-school students from San Jose\, CA\, who compete in a nationwide tournament to code satellites aboard the International Space Station. Seen through the wondrous eyes of three young students and their first-time coach\, they each take an intimate and personal journey to space as their team grows from amateur coders to representing California in the ISS Finals Tournament – the culmination of a summer-long adventure that sees their incredible accomplishment performed by astronauts in orbit. \nThis event will feature a special presentation by the University of Houston’s SACNAS Chapter. SACNAS\, or the Society for Advancement of Chicanos/Hispanics and Native Americans in Science\, is an inclusive national organization dedicated to fostering the success of diverse scientists\, from college students to professionals\, in attaining research opportunities\, advanced degrees\, careers\, and positions of leadership in Science\, Technology\, Engineering\, and Math (STEM). SACNAS works to support the most underrepresented in STEM.  \nThis event is free and open to the public.
